Ingredients

  • One dozen plain donuts: choose soft and fresh donuts for the best result store bought is perfect if you are in a hurry
  • One cup chocolate frosting: this adds a rich base for your spiders you can pick creamy store bought or whip up your own
  • One cup black licorice: cut into strips for realistic spider legs always check that it is soft and flexible for easier decorating
  • Twelve candy eyes: these bring your spiders to life look for them in the baking aisle or craft section for convenience

Tips for picking ingredients

quality matters with donuts use the freshest ones you can find and go for frosting that is smooth and spreadable to avoid tearing your donuts

Step-by-Step Instructions

Prep Your Workspace:
Place your plain donuts on a large plate or line a baking sheet with parchment paper to keep things tidy and make decorating easy
Frost the Donuts:
Spread a thick even layer of chocolate frosting over the top of each donut use a small spatula or the back of a spoon and make sure you get all the way to the edges this helps the decorations stick
Add Spider Legs:
Cut black licorice into pieces about three to four inches long position four strips on each side of every donut push them gently into the frosting so they stay in place let the legs fan out to look like spiders
Attach Candy Eyes:
Place two candy eyes near the center of each frosted donut gently press so they stick if you want extra character tilt the eyes or space them apart
Set and Serve:
Let the decorated donuts rest for five minutes so the frosting sets slightly they are ready to enjoy or to display on your party table

Storage Tips

Keep your Spider Donuts in an airtight container at room temperature and they will stay soft for up to three days If you have extras you can refrigerate them but the texture of both donut and frosting may change slightly
To freeze wrap each donut individually in plastic wrap and store in a freezer safe bag they last for a month Defrost overnight in the fridge and bring to room temperature before serving
If you want to serve them warm pop one in the microwave for about ten seconds to soften but watch so the frosting does not melt completely

Ingredient Substitutions

Not a fan of licorice Use thin pretzel sticks or chocolate covered pretzels for legs Want a nutty twist Try almond slivers for tiny legs
Choose vanilla or orange frosting for a Halloween color boost and top with rainbow sugar eyes or mini marshmallows for playful faces
Look for gluten free or dairy free donuts and frosting to make this treat friendly for everyone at your gathering

What You'll Need

→ Main Components

Ingredient 01 12 plain yeast-raised donuts
Ingredient 02 240 ml chocolate frosting
Ingredient 03 100 g black licorice, cut into strips
Ingredient 04 24 edible candy eyes

How to Make It

Instruction 01

Arrange the donuts on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per to facilitate easy decorating.

Instruction 02

Evenly spread a generous layer of chocolate frosting over the top of each donut, ensuring full coverage.

Instruction 03

Cut black licorice into strips approximately 8-10 cm in length. Affix four strips to each side of every donut to form spider legs, gently pressing them into the frosting.

Instruction 04

Position two candy eyes atop each frosted donut in the central area, pressing lightly to secure.

Instruction 05

Let the decorated donuts rest for several minutes to allow the frosting to firm up. Serve when ready.

Additional Tips

  1. For optimal taste and texture, decorate with freshly purchased donuts on the day of serving.
  2. Gently warm chocolate frosting in the microwave for easier spreading, using short 5-second intervals.
  3. Alternative decorations, such as pretzel sticks or colored candies, can be used for creative presentation.
  4. Store finished donuts in an airtight container for up to 3 days at room temperature.
